Key material properties
| Density | 0.997 g/cm3 |
|---|---|
| Young's modulus | 1.62 GPa |
| Yield strength | 29.4 MPa (representative value; grade and condition dependent) |
| Thermal conductivity | 0.2 W/mK |
| Heat resistance / melting point | 90 C |
Published property ranges
| Density (g/cm3) | CAMPUS Plastics: 0.961–1.086; MatWeb: 0.982–1.054; Polymer handbook: 1.002–1.077 |
|---|---|
| Young's modulus (GPa) | CAMPUS Plastics: 1.559–1.869; MatWeb: 1.642–1.741; Polymer handbook: 1.725–1.832 |
| Thermal conductivity (W/mK) | CAMPUS Plastics: 0.189–0.259; MatWeb: 0.214–0.221; Polymer handbook: 0.239–0.248 |
Ranges are representative values from the cited handbooks/datasheets; use manufacturer datasheets for design allowables.
